Vanguard Capital Wealth Advisors Makes New Investment in Cameco Co. (NYSE:CCJ)

Cameco logo with Basic Materials background

Vanguard Capital Wealth Advisors acquired a new stake in shares of Cameco Co. (NYSE:CCJ - Free Report) TSE: CCO in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The firm acquired 16,330 shares of the basic materials company's stock, valued at approximately $839,000. Cameco makes up 0.9% of Vanguard Capital Wealth Advisors' holdings, making the stock its 20th biggest position.

Several other institutional investors and hedge funds have also recently modified their holdings of CCJ. Norges Bank bought a new position in shares of Cameco in the 4th quarter worth $188,595,000. FMR LLC raised its holdings in Cameco by 8.7% in the fourth quarter. FMR LLC now owns 22,639,647 shares of the basic materials company's stock worth $1,163,942,000 after purchasing an additional 1,811,876 shares in the last quarter. Driehaus Capital Management LLC lifted its position in shares of Cameco by 120.2% during the fourth quarter. Driehaus Capital Management LLC now owns 2,245,539 shares of the basic materials company's stock valued at $115,398,000 after buying an additional 1,225,966 shares during the last quarter. Alliancebernstein L.P. boosted its holdings in shares of Cameco by 13.5% in the 4th quarter. Alliancebernstein L.P. now owns 10,088,407 shares of the basic materials company's stock valued at $518,443,000 after buying an additional 1,196,336 shares in the last quarter. Finally, AGF Management Ltd. raised its stake in shares of Cameco by 54.2% during the 4th quarter. AGF Management Ltd. now owns 3,393,233 shares of the basic materials company's stock worth $174,433,000 after acquiring an additional 1,193,266 shares in the last quarter. Institutional investors own 70.21% of the company's stock.

Cameco Trading Down 0.2%

Shares of Cameco stock opened at $51.16 on Tuesday. The stock's 50 day simple moving average is $43.90 and its 200-day simple moving average is $48.81.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.20, a current ratio of 2.88 and a quick ratio of 1.26. The stock has a market cap of $22.27 billion, a P/E ratio of 182.71 and a beta of 0.89. Cameco Co. has a 1-year low of $35.00 and a 1-year high of $62.55.

Cameco (NYSE:CCJ - Get Free Report) TSE: CCO last posted its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The basic materials company reported $0.11 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.18 by ($0.07). Cameco had a net margin of 5.39% and a return on equity of 4.34%. The firm had revenue of $549.58 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$890.07 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$0.13 earnings per share.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 24.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ts predict that Cameco Co. will post 1.27 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Cameco Profile

(Free Report)

Cameco Corporation provides uranium for the generation of electricity. It operates through Uranium, Fuel Services, Westinghouse segments. The Uranium segment is involved in the exploration for, mining, and milling, purchase, and sale of uranium concentrate. The Fuel Services segment engages in the refining, conversion, and fabrication of uranium concentrate, as well as the purchase and sale of conversion services.
